Olivier Kapo Happy Now That Bruce Has Gone


Wigan Athletic's forgotten man, France international Olivier Kapo has poured cold water on any rumour suggesting that he is looking to get out of the DW Stadium.

Speaking to the Wigan Evening Post the former Juventus player says that he is very happy at the Latics and that is where he wants to stay, why? Well he says it`s because Steve Bruce has left the club.

Kapo reveals that he had major problems with former boss Steve Bruce last season but now that Bruce has left and gone to Sunderland Kapo sees his future firmly at the Latics

The attacking midfield man suffered a knee ligament injury during pre-season and fully recovered with two reserve games under his belt Kapo is chomping at the bit to be given a chance to prove his worth to new boss Roberto Martinez.

Kapo told the Post: 'It seems that every summer I am linked with another club, particularly in France, but the truth is that I want to be here at Wigan, where I'm happy'

'Last season was very difficult for me, because I had problems with Steve Bruce. I don't have that now.

'I know the Premier League and, although the last year has been difficult, the bottom line is that I want to play.

'If the team don't want me that's another question, but personally I want to play for Wigan Athletic, no one else.

'I have a three-year contract. I like Wigan. It's where I want to be. I want to stay.'


A happy and dedicated Kapo would be like having a new player at the club, he is definitely talented and would slot into the attacking midfield role quite comfortably
